Lines Matching refs:p
48 zval *p, *end; in zend_object_std_dtor() local
62 p = object->properties_table; in zend_object_std_dtor()
64 end = p + object->ce->default_properties_count; in zend_object_std_dtor()
66 if (Z_REFCOUNTED_P(p)) { in zend_object_std_dtor()
67 if (UNEXPECTED(Z_ISREF_P(p)) && in zend_object_std_dtor()
68 (ZEND_DEBUG || ZEND_REF_HAS_TYPE_SOURCES(Z_REF_P(p)))) { in zend_object_std_dtor()
69 zend_property_info *prop_info = zend_get_property_info_for_slot(object, p); in zend_object_std_dtor()
71 ZEND_REF_DEL_TYPE_SOURCE(Z_REF_P(p), prop_info); in zend_object_std_dtor()
74 i_zval_ptr_dtor(p); in zend_object_std_dtor()
76 p++; in zend_object_std_dtor()
77 } while (p != end); in zend_object_std_dtor()
81 if (EXPECTED(Z_TYPE_P(p) == IS_STRING)) { in zend_object_std_dtor()
82 zval_ptr_dtor_str(p); in zend_object_std_dtor()
83 } else if (Z_TYPE_P(p) == IS_ARRAY) { in zend_object_std_dtor()
86 guards = Z_ARRVAL_P(p); in zend_object_std_dtor()
273 zval *p = new_object->properties_table; in zend_objects_clone_obj() local
274 zval *end = p + new_object->ce->default_properties_count; in zend_objects_clone_obj()
276 ZVAL_UNDEF(p); in zend_objects_clone_obj()
277 p++; in zend_objects_clone_obj()
278 } while (p != end); in zend_objects_clone_obj()